How can you not want to jump offstage for Chon? The band is getting ready to release a live DVD — and you can preview 4 minutes of it right now.

The DVD was filmed during the band’s Super CHON Bros Tour last year with Polyphia and Strawberry Girls.

This is their video for “Perfect Pillow.” Which you can see them play on their co-headlining tour beginning next week with Dance Gavin Dance.

PS – a release date for the DVD has yet to be announced.
